Emergent Spectral Degeneracies In The Quantum Phase Transitions In The Interacting Boson Model |

| The energy degeneracies emerging in the critical region of the interacting boson model are systematically investigated.The results indicate that the level-crossings in the transitions from the U(7)5(8)to the SU(7)3(8)quasidynamical symmetry can induce the approximate spectral degeneracies along the first-order transitional line for large boson number N.The remnant of this type of degeneracies in finite-N systems have been preliminarily identified from the low-lying spectrum of150 Nd.In addition,the similar approximate degeneracies emerging in the phase transition between the U(7)5(8)and SO(7)6(8)quasidynamical symmetries are parallel emphasized. |
